Ingredients

 Vegetable oil1 Tablespoon
 4 pork butterfly steaks
 2 apples, cored, peeled and cut Into thick slices
 60 g/2 oz dried apricots
 Brown sugar1 Tablespoon
 1 tablespoon chopped fresh thyme or 1 teaspoon dried thyme
 Spicy marinade
 Garlic1 Clove (5gm), crushed
 Chili powder1/2 Teaspoon
 1/4 cup/60 ml/2 fl oz apple juice
 Vegetable oil1 Tablespoon
 Malt vinegar1 Tablespoon

Directions

1. To make marinade, whisk garlic, chili powder, apple juice, oil and vinegar in a bowl. Place steaks in a shallow ceramic or glass dish. Pour marinade over steaks, cover and marinate in the refrigerator for 2-3 hours or overnight. Drain steaks and reserve marinade.
2. Heat oil in a frying pan over a high heat. Cook steaks for 5 minutes each side. Add reserved marinade, apples, apricots, sugar and thyme and bring to the bo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 5 minutes or until sauce thickens slightly and pork is tender.
